Subject: Key rotation — cold storage archiving

Welcome aboard. We rotated credentials for the Frostvault archiver last night. The old key stops working Friday. All cold storage buckets slated for archive must be processed with the new credential via the archiver CLI. Do not reuse the staging key. Scope is read-plus-seal only. The replacement key for the archiving service follows below.

service key, fawip-bajef: kto11_Qt5wZK9vdNC

## Releases

Hey support folks — quick notes on ProfileMesh shard releases. Each release re-balances user-profile shards gradually, so don't panic if a lookup lands on a stale shard for a few minutes post-deploy; it self-heals. Release bundles are published twice a month and are always signed. If a customer asks you to verify a bundle they downloaded, walk them through the checksum step using the public signing key below.

deploy key for kawif-bageg: bky19_YQNdHDgpaLxUNwPoHm9

**Ticket: Drift in Farrowby fee rules**

The Farrowby rules engine in prod no longer matches what's in the repo. Someone hand-edited the surcharge tiers during the holiday rush and never backported the change. New folks: never edit live configs directly. To fix, redeploy from source and verify. The expected baseline configuration is as follows.

deployment values, yadug-bawif:
[framir]
team = pelox
access_code = ac_a38ab2
owner = tamion.julael
host = framir.tolvaqlabs.test
port = 11211
peer = tammir.zemvargrid.local
salt = 2215ef03
pin = 1541

Q3 Planning Note — Warranty Cost Overrun

Finance team: warranty claims on the Brindlecore X2 line exceeded plan by 38% this quarter, driven by the actuator fault flagged in July. Accrual adjustments are booked; expect a further true-up in Q4. Vellmark Components has accepted partial liability, terms pending. Model the revised reserve into next quarter's forecast before Thursday's review. Context on where this leaves the broader plan follows below.

board note of bawep-tajef: Queniusek Systems plans to raise the Quenvan list price by 53.1 percent in March. The pricing group signed off on a budget of $176.4 million for Project Drueth. The renewal with Casionix Partners closes at $142.5 million a year, 8.3 percent below the last contract. Project Fraax slips by six weeks because of the tooling delay.